Job summary
We have an exciting opportunity for an enthusiastic and motivated Advanced Audiologist to join us in the Paediatric Audiology team at Basildon and Thurrock Hospitals to develop our family friendly hearing service.
The post holder will be fully competent in all areas of advanced paediatric hearing assessment, including evoked potential (including under anaesthetic in operating theatre), behavioural testing including visual reinforcement audiometry. Have knowledge of global child development.
Main duties of the jobThe post holder will be able to identify appropriate testing programme for each individual case and interpret results, including complex cases.
The post holder will be able to identify and implement programme of care based on results obtained, consistent with current professional body protocols and new developments in the science of Audiology. Exceptional communication abilities are required for counselling parents of newly diagnosed deaf babies and children. Understanding of grief counselling will be vital.
The post holder will be responsible for paediatric service provision, and able to deputise for manager when necessary. This will require planning time of junior staff and establishing of training programmes.
Be liaison for local Specialist Teachers of the Deaf to ensure children benefit from the prescribed amplification and radio aid provision in educational setting, reviewing cases as necessary.
Be lead for paediatric audit and journal study
To assist in the policy formulation of the Paediatric service. This will impact on other services including ENT and community audiology.
Ensure correct use of evoked potentials equipment and ensure equipment is giving accurate data
